What type of rental buildings are in Greenville, NC?
In Greenville, 67% of the residents are renting compared to 33% owning a home, according to data from the U.S. Census Bureau. Large-scale apartment buildings with more than 50 units represent 6% of Greenville's rentals, 80% are small-scale complexes with under 50 units, and 13% are single-family rentals.
